Manufactured under strict quality controls, this carbon steel U-bolt is designed for 2" nominal pipe size applications. It features an inside width (A) of 3.30 inches and an inside length (B) of 4.51 inches, accommodating pipe O.D. variations within tolerance. The threads are 1/2"-13 UNC, providing ample engagement for secure fastening with appropriate nuts and washers (sold separately). The material's inherent tensile strength and durability make it suitable for environments requiring reliable structural support and resistance to moderate corrosive conditions.

| ❌ Mistake | ✅ Correct Approach |
|---|---|
| Using the wrong size U-bolt for the pipe's outer diameter. | Always confirm the nominal pipe size and its corresponding outer diameter to select a U-bolt with the correct inside width and length to ensure a snug fit. |
| Over-tightening the nuts, causing pipe deformation or stress. | Tighten nuts progressively and evenly on both legs. Torque to manufacturer's recommendations or until the pipe is held firmly without visible deformation. |
